How Pocket Sliding Doors Maximize Space in Your Home
Barn sliding doors add charm and character, but pocket sliding doors present a practical solution for maximizing space in a home. These innovative doors slide seamlessly into the wall, doing away with the need for swing space that standard doors demand. This solution helps homeowners maximize their living areas, particularly in smaller rooms where every inch counts.
Pocket doors are well-suited for compact areas, such as bathrooms or closets, where traditional doors may restrict movement. Their elegant look also enhances a sleek aesthetic, making them a stylish choice for modern living spaces. Furthermore, pocket doors can optimize the transition between rooms, creating an open atmosphere while offering privacy as required.
Fundamentally, pocket sliding doors merge practicality with style, making them a wise investment for homeowners and renovators aiming to make the most of their space without giving up aesthetic appeal.

Questions Our Clients Often Ask
How Can I Maintain Sliding Doors for Long-Term Use?
To maintain sliding doors for longevity, routine track cleaning, greasing of rollers, and checking for signs of wear are critical. Maintaining correct alignment and resolving problems quickly can significantly improve their durability and performance.
Do Sliding Doors Help Improve Energy Efficiency?
Sliding doors are capable of improving energy efficiency when fitted and sealed with care. Today's designs commonly include double glazing and insulated frames, reducing heat loss and enhancing climate control, consequently reducing energy bills and enhancing overall comfort within the home.
Which Materials Work Best for Sliding Doors?
Aluminum, fiberglass, and vinyl represent ideal choices for sliding doors because of their strength, minimal upkeep, and energy-saving properties. Wood provides visual charm but requires more upkeep to prevent warping and damage from moisture.
Do Sliding Doors Provide Security Against Break-Ins?
Sliding doors may be secure against break-ins when equipped with reinforced glass, proper framing, and quality locks. That said, the level of security they provide frequently relies on the quality of installation and extra safeguards like security bars or alarms to improve overall security.
How Much Does a Sliding Door Usually Cost?
Sliding doors generally cost anywhere from $300 to $2,500, depending on materials, design, and installation. Premium materials and custom designs can significantly raise the total cost, while standard models generally remain more affordable.
